SPECTRE: Bond’s Biggest Opening Sequence “Writing’s on the Wall” Music Video Gallery Spectre is the first Bond film since Die Another Day (2002) to feature the iconic gun barrel sequence at the start of the film. While it was used as part of the title sequence in Casino Royale (2006), the sequence was only shown at the end of Skyfall and Quantum of Solace .

Daniel Craig’s fourth outing as 007 may lack the frantic pace and emotional impact of predecessor Skyfall , but it’s a treat for longtime Bond devotees, despite featuring one of the most boring theme songs in the series’ history, and an even worse title sequence (involving a threesome between Bond, a Bond girl, and an octopus!). to business with a spectacular opening set during Mexico’s Day of the Dead festival, and follows it up with the return of an old nemesis and more revelations regarding Bond’s recent misfortunes. Tarantino favourite Christoph Waltz is the latest actor to lead the eponymous organisation, and although his character’s true identity was kept a secret, the appearance of a

white cat pretty much spills the beans. Additionally, much was made of Monica Bellucci’s casting as a Bond girl, but don’t expect to see her for more than a few minutes. If this is indeed Daniel Craig’s swan song as Bond – and watching Spectre , you sort of get the feeling it is – it’s a fitting send off in the spirit of From Russia with Love . SH • See page 28

With the rise of the Internet came a need for increased security vigilance, so naturally a whole industry sprang forth to provide safe passage online. It’s also inspired many fictional tales, with varying degrees of authenticity. In Mr. Robot we enter the orbit of young programmer Elliot Alderson (Rami Malek), a cybersecurity whiz working for Allsafe. A client of theirs is E Corp, one of the largest, most

Each episode title in Season One ends in a video file name extension like .flv or .mov Rami Malek was hired to play the lead, Elliot Alderson, because creator Sam Esmail’s then-girlfriend had seen him in miniseries The Pacific and recommended him for the lead.

all-pervading corporations in the world. Through the eyes of Elliot, however, they become ‘Evil Corp’, and this is a hint at the bigger picture surrounding our protagonist – suffering from social anxiety disorder and clinical depression, he’s prone to being delusional. He connects with others – be they potential friend or foe – by hacking them, turning vigilante on those he feels are perpetrating wrongs. When mysterious

anarchist Mr. Robot (Christian Slater) courts Elliot for his hacktivist group fsociety, the stakes notch up, as they want to bring down the company that he’s paid to protect – yes, E Corp... Essential viewing for even the least paranoid, Mr. Robot grabs hold from the outset, keeping you questioning most everything encountered over its rollercoaster 10-episode journey. AF
